What Exactly Is HQP?

HQP (High-Quality Poop) means your digestive system is doing its job well — breaking food down, absorbing nutrients, feeding beneficial gut bacteria, and eliminating waste efficiently.

When your gut is supported, your poop is usually:

  • Easy to pass
  • Well-formed
  • Consistent
  • Predictable
  • Not painful or urgent

In short: boring poop is good poop.

The 5 Signs of HQP

1. Color: Brown

Brown stool signals healthy bile flow and proper fat digestion.

2. Shape: Smooth & Sausage-Like

On the Bristol Stool Chart, Types 3–4 reflect HQP. Not pebbles. Not mush. Not liquid.

3. Consistency: Soft but Solid

HQP holds together without being hard — a sign of adequate fiber, hydration, and balanced gut bacteria.

4. Frequency: Regular & Comfortable

HQP typically happens daily or every other day, without straining, urgency, or skipped days.

5. Smell: Noticeable, Not Overpowering

Poop smells — that's normal. But extremely foul or lingering odor may point to digestive imbalance.

When Poop Is Not HQP

Low-quality stool may include:

  • Hard pellets or constipation
  • Loose, watery, or urgent stools
  • Floating, greasy, or shiny stool
  • Strong or foul odor
  • Inconsistent patterns

These signs aren't a failure — they're signals your gut needs support.
